As expected the Brookfield East boys tennis team split two matches at the WIAA Team Tennis Tournament at the Nielsen Center in Madison on Friday and Saturday.
The Spartans whipped Green Bay Preble, 6-1, in the quarterfinals on Friday to open the week and then suffered their worst beating of the year to Marquette, 7-0, on Saturday morning.
Sophomore Felix Corwin of Brookfield East beat senior Mason Mattila of Preble (6-0, 6-0) at Flight 1, while in Flight 2 junior Tim Corwin beat junior Brad Maccoux (6-0, 6-0).
Flight 3 saw East freshman Tyler Kendler whip junior Hoi-An Thai (6-0, 6-0) while senior Michael Amato of East defeated sophomore Will Griswold (6-1, 6-0) in Flight 4.
On the doubles side, East senior Ben Klein/sophomore Ben Stewart beat seniors Jaren Sternard/Andrew McDonald (6-3, 6-3) in Flight 1 and in Flight 3 senior Billy Dietz/junior Michael Wolff defeated seniors AJ Kempke/Cristian Vasiliev (6-3, 6-0).
In Flight 2 Preble junior Kurt Ahonen/sophomore Brennan Dougherty beat East juniors Cole Leonovicz/Jimmy Engelhart (6-1, 6-4).
On Saturday against Marquette in the semifinals, the Spartans were hoping to have better luck this time around after losing 6-1 and 5-2 in the regular season.
It didn't happen as the Hilltoppers won every match.
In singles junior Damon Niquet beat Felix Corwin (7-6 (1), 6-1) and junior Matt Lynch beat Tim Corwin (7-5, 6-3) in Flight 1 and Flight 2, respectively.
In a battle of freshmen in Flight 3, David Sinense beat Kendler (6-2, 6-1). Another Marquette freshman, Alex Rokosz, won in Flight 4, defeating Amato (6-1, 6-1).
In doubles, two of the three battles were close.
In Flight 1 junior CJ Armbrust/senior Connor Muth beat Klein/Stewart (6-1, 7-6 (4)) and in Flight 3 junior Mike Ebsen/senior Troy Holland beat Dietz/Wolff (6-3, 2-6, 6-1).
In Flight 2 sophomore Austin Budiono/junior Greg Raster defeated Leonovicz/Engelhart (6-2, 6-3).
TEAM TENNIS
Quarterfinals, Friday
Brookfield East 6, Green Bay Preble 1
Marquette 7, Middleton 0
Eau Claire Memorial 7, Waukesha West 0
Homestead 6, Kenosha Tremper 1
Semifinals, Saturday
Marquette 7, Brookfield East 0
Homestead, 6, EC Memorial 1
Championship Match, Saturday
Marquette 5, Homestead 2
